UPDATED: Police locate missing Reading woman

Staff Writer by Staff Writer
Thursday, April 17, 2025 4:18 pm
in Crime, Featured, Reading
A A
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

UPDATE: Police have now located the subject of this missing person’s report safely.

Some details of the report below have been removed to preserve their privacy.

– – – – – – – – –

THAMES Valley Police is appealing for help locating a woman reported missing from Reading.

Police are extremely concerned for the welfare of a woman who has been reported as missing.

She is described as being 5ft 3ins tall and of slim build.
